Why DirecTV May Not Work on Smart TV
Several factors can prevent DirecTV from working on a Smart TV:
- Internet Connectivity Issues
Slow or unstable Wi-Fi can cause the app to freeze, buffer, or fail to load. - Outdated App or Smart TV Firmware
Older versions of the DirecTV app or Smart TV software may lead to compatibility issues. - Corrupted App Data or Cache
Accumulated temporary files can interfere with app performance. - Server Issues
DirecTV servers may be temporarily down or undergoing maintenance. - Account or Subscription Problems
Incorrect login credentials or inactive subscriptions may block access. - Hardware or Connectivity Glitches
HDMI, Ethernet, or Wi-Fi connectivity issues may prevent proper streaming.

How to Fix DirecTV Not Working on Smart TV
Follow these steps to troubleshoot and fix the DirecTV app:
1. Check Your Internet Connection
- Ensure your Smart TV is connected to a stable Wi-Fi or Ethernet network.
- Test other apps like Netflix or YouTube to confirm connectivity.
- Restart your modem or router if necessary.
2. Restart the DirecTV App
- Close the app completely and relaunch it.
- On Smart TVs, navigate to the home screen and reopen the app to refresh the session.
3. Update the DirecTV App
- Go to your Smart TV’s app store and check for updates.
- Installing the latest version resolves compatibility issues and bugs.
4. Restart Your Smart TV
- Power off your Smart TV, unplug it for a few minutes, and then plug it back in.
- Restarting clears temporary glitches and refreshes system memory.
5. Clear Cache and Temporary Data
- On Smart TVs that allow clearing cache, go to app settings and clear cache/data.
- Relaunch the app after clearing to resolve performance issues.
6. Verify DirecTV Account
- Ensure your login credentials are correct and your subscription is active.
- Log out and log back in if necessary.
7. Reinstall the DirecTV App
- Uninstall the app from your Smart TV, then reinstall it from the app store.
- This resolves corrupted files and ensures a fresh installation.
8. Check DirecTV Server Status
- Streaming issues may sometimes be due to server outages.
- Verify DirecTV’s service status through official channels or social media updates.
9. Test on Another Device
- Try accessing DirecTV on a mobile device or another Smart TV to determine if the issue is device-specific.
10. Contact DirecTV Support
- If all else fails, contact DirecTV support for assistance.
- Provide details such as TV model, error messages, and troubleshooting steps already attempted.
Additional Tips for Smooth Streaming on Smart TV
- Enable Automatic Updates: Keep the app and TV firmware updated.
- Use Wired Connections: Ethernet is more reliable than Wi-Fi for high-definition streaming.
- Restart Devices Regularly: Prevent glitches by rebooting weekly.
- Limit Background Apps: Close other apps that may use bandwidth or memory while streaming.
